melange's world-writable permissions expose SBOM files to potential image tampering

GHSA-5662-cv6m-63wh · CVE-2025-54059 · GO-2025-3815

Published · Modified

Description

It was discovered that the SBOM files generated by melange in apks had file system permissions mode 666:

$ apkrane ls https://packages.wolfi.dev/os/x86_64/APKINDEX.tar.gz -P hello-wolfi --full --latest  | xargs wget -q -O  - | tar tzv 2>/dev/null var/lib/db/sbom
drwxr-xr-x root/root         0 2025-06-23 14:17 var/lib/db/sbom
-rw-rw-rw- root/root      3383 2025-06-23 14:17 var/lib/db/sbom/hello-wolfi-2.12.2-r1.spdx.json

This issue was introduced in commit 1b272db ("Persist workspace filesystem throughout package builds (#1836)") (v0.23.0).

Impact

This potentially allows an unprivileged user to tamper with apk SBOMs on a running image, potentially confusing security scanners. An attacker could also perform a DoS under special circumstances.

Patches

This issue was addressed in melange in e29494b ("fix: tighten up permissions for written SBOM files and signature tarballs (#2086)") (v0.29.5).

Acknowledgements

Thanks to Cody Harris H2O.ai and Markus Boehme for independently reporting this issue.
